Features:
  • MP3 Flash Player with 2 GB Digital Audio Capacity
  • Compatible with iTunes
  • Features: Lightweight, USB Ready for High Speed Data Transfer, Anodized Aluminum Body, PC-Chargeable Battery, Compact
  • Stores Approximately 500 Songs
  • Battery Lasts Up to 12.0 Hr
  • Reads AAC, WMA, MP3
  • Modes: Shuffle Songs, On/Off/Pause/Play
  • Includes Belt Clip, Quick Start Guide, Earphones
  • 1 Year Limited Warranty, 90 Day Single Incident Phone Support
  • 1.62 x 1.07 x 0.41

4 out of 5 stars Far more durable than I believed   November 16, 2008
Seren Ade (UK)
3 out of 3 found this review helpful

OK, the iPod shuffle isn't by any means the most sophisticated mp3 player on the market: indeed without a screen there's nothing to allow you to select specific tracks you want to play. And there're no track/artist details available through the player... to achieve these things you have to rely on iTunes. The choices you have are to play through tracks in the order you programmed them to appear (through iTunes), or to select 'shuffle' for random sequencing.

The lack of basic track info is annoying, since even some very rudimentary players are able to output an lcd display with track names.
However, as a basic player that you can take anywhere with minimal intrusion into your life, the ipod shuffle is exemplary.

It has recently been the unobtrusive nature of the shuffle which has led to my discovering how durable it CAN be! Following an evening out, I unplugged my earphones and inadvertently left my shuffle clipped to a jacket... which I washed and tumble dried.

1 week later, and thoroughly dried out, my shuffle works perfectly. With only minor scrapes on the edges of the player and clip to show for its ordeal by washing machine, I'm impressed by this durability!

5 out of 5 stars Quality - You get what you pay for   September 19, 2008
Mr. S. J. Morawiec (Dorset)
13 out of 13 found this review helpful

OK, why the five stars? No graphic display, limited functionality when compared to more larger, more expensive items, but let's take a closer look.

Having owned a number of MP3 players, including the oft maligned ipod 80gb, this gadget is really very smart. It is exactly what it was meant to be and for a little over 40.00 represents excellent value over its competitors. Apple have got the right idea, storing over 500 songs, it is small enough to clip on a t-shirt, but stores sufficient music or podcasts for me to travel to New York and back and still barely scratch the surface of what I had stored on it. What else is small? Well not the battery life, that's for sure and whilst the headphones are poor, it was not so long ago that I paid this amount for a player which was powered by an A3 alkaline, with earphones that were so poor they defied belief.

In regards to the lack of graphic display. Let's get real, whilst I have loaded this up to the brim, for a fifty something, I find that 10 albums is enough and them change the playlist. But for a budget conscious young (or not so young) person, this item represents good value if you fill it up to the brim.
